Valieva became the champion of Russia in figure skating with record points

For the first time in her career, Kamila Valieva won gold at the Russian Figure Skating Championship in singles competitions. In total, for the short and free program, she scored 283.48 (90.38 + 193.10) points.

The 15-year-old figure skater scored above her own world records in the free program (185.29) and in total (272.71). In national competitions, official records will not count.

The second was Alexandra Trusova (248.65; 74.21 + 174.44). The 2021 world champion Anna Shcherbakova, who won the last three Russian championships, took third place (239.56; 158.10 + 81.46).

She was the first in the history of women's single skating to perform two quadruple rittberger in one program. Valieva, Trusova, Shcherbakova and Petrosyan train in the group of Eteri Tutberidze.

Evgeni Plushenko's student Sofia Muravyova, who was third after the short program, took sixth place (230.31; 80.87 + 149.44).

World Champion 2015, World Cup 2021 silver medalist Elizaveta Tuktamysheva became the seventh (224.40; 71.28 + 153.12). In total, the 25-year-old athlete performed at her 14th Russian championship, this is a record. She won only once - in 2013.

Earlier in the men's competition, Mark Kondratyuk became the champion of Russia, Alexandra Stepanova and Ivan Bukin won ice dancing, and Anastasia Mishina and Alexander Gallyamov became the best in pair skating.

The competitive part of the Russian championship, which takes place in St. Petersburg, has ended, on Sunday the skaters will skate demonstration numbers. The tournament was very important in terms of selection for the Beijing Olympics, where Russia has three quotas in each of the four types of program in figure skating competitions.

The next major international tournament, the European Championship, will take place in Tallinn from 12 to 16 January. The Olympic Games will be held in Beijing from 4 to 20 February.
